Maple Donut Bars From Scratch

Delicious homemade maple donut bars, perfect for breakfast or a sweet treat.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Breakfast, Dessert
Cuisine: American
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

Donut Bar Ingredients
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tbs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 large egg beaten
  • 1/2 cup milk whole or 2%
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ter melted
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
Maple Glaze Ingredients
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 2 tbsp maple syrup
  • 2 tbsp milk adjust for consistency
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la extract

Method
 

Prepare the Donut Bars
  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a baking pan.
  2. In a m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, combine the beaten egg, milk, melted butter, and vanilla extract.
  4.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and mix until just combined.
  5. Spread the batter evenly in the prepared baking pan.
  6. Bake for 20-25 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  7. Allow to c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then transfer to a cooling rack.
Make the Maple Glaze
  1. In a small bowl, whisk together the powdered sugar, maple syrup, milk, and vanilla extract.
  2. Adjust the milk to achieve desired glaze consistency.
  3. Once the donut bars are completely cool, drizzle the glaze over the top.
  4. Let the glaze set for a few minutes before slicing into bars.

Notes

Store leftover donut bars in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
